On both of these grounded. tion (120 or 277 volts) is only available as single-phase. The high-voltage (208 or 480 volts) is available as either single-phase or 3-phase. It should be noted that in the 4-wire ground-ed wye systems the high-voltage is 1.73 times (the square root of 3) higher than the low voltage.
Motors work based upon a V/Hz ratio. Motors for use in the US are designed around our utility voltage of 480V 60Hz, so 460/60=7.6V/Hz. Your motor is designed around 380V 50Hz, and 380/50=7.6V/Hz! Can you run a 380V motor on 480V? The drive will accept 380V, no problem. But the output voltage will be limited by that as well, standard VFDs cannot provide an output voltage that is greater than the input voltage. So if your motor is designed for 480V, you will end up with a limited speed or a loss of torque.

Internally a VFD runs on DC. Most VFDs will accept single phase outright and convert to three phase as long as you double the rating. So for a 10 kw motor you need a 20 kw drive. There are also voltage doubler drives. So they will convert say single phase 120 to 3 phase 230. These are the ones that are used for training/demo drives.
